The grapple/harpoon tool looks like one of the game's neatest toys - was it always part of the game's design or an accidental inclusion?

It sure wasn't meant to be so prominent to begin with. But it's just so darn fun to play around with, so we added feature upon feature to it. Now the grappler is Rico's favorite tool, especially when he gets to use it with his trusty ever-spawning parachute.

Is there going to be any multiplayer on offer?

No, no multiplayer whatsoever.
